Optimal management of multivessel disease (MVD) requires individualized treatment plans. Decisions involve percutaneous coronary intervention, bypass surgery, or medical therapy, guided by patient factors and disease severity.

Background:

  • Multivessel disease (MVD) management is complex, impacting patient prognosis.
  • Clinical and angiographic scores aid treatment decisions but individualization is key.
  • Choosing between revascularization (PCI/CABG) and guideline-directed medical therapy (GDMT) is critical.

Purpose of the Study:

  • To review optimal management strategies for multivessel coronary artery disease.
  • To discuss factors influencing the choice between revascularization and medical therapy.
  • To explore various aspects of MVD treatment, including revascularization extent and guidance strategies.

Main Methods:

  • Review of current literature and clinical guidelines on MVD management.
  • Analysis of patient-specific factors influencing treatment decisions.
  • Discussion of comparative outcomes for different revascularization strategies.

Main Results:

  • Individualized patient assessment is paramount in MVD management.
  • Treatment selection (PCI, CABG, GDMT) depends on clinical presentation, disease severity, and patient preference.
  • Strategies include complete vs. incomplete revascularization and angiography- vs. ischemia-guided approaches.

Conclusions:

  • Optimal MVD management necessitates a personalized approach integrating clinical, angiographic, and patient factors.
  • The choice of revascularization modality and extent significantly influences outcomes.
  • Guideline-directed medical therapy remains a crucial component, especially when revascularization is not indicated or feasible.
